Portland is the largest and most populous city in Oregon, located at the Willamette and Columbia rivers' confluence. Outside of OHSU, our residents have the opportunity to explore a culturally diverse city with numerous restaurants, breweries, performing arts, and music venues.

Convenient housing opportunities allow for a short commute to the hospital in urban and suburban settings located in some of the state's best-ranked school systems.

With all of the Pacific Northwest wonders at their fingertips, our residents frequently explore the great outdoors, including hiking in the numerous urban parks and the Columbia River Gorge, ski trips to Mount Hood, wine tasting in the Willamette Valley, and surfing at the infamous Oregon coast. Our city truly allows for exploration during all four seasons.
